Diameter The major diameter is determined by the thread tips. WebHow do you identify BSP and NPT threads? However, the designs of the threads differ in two fundamental ways. With NPT, the peaks and valleys of the threads are flat. In BSP, they are rounded. Secondly, the NPT angle of the thread is 60 degrees and the BSP angle is 55 degrees. WebMar 31, 2024 · The British Standard Pipe Thread standard (BSP) is used. There are two versions of BSP: BSPP (British Standard Pipe Parallel) BSPT (British Standard Pipe Tapered) BSPP is used for garden hoses (but usually just referred to as "BSP".) Most garden taps have a 3/4 inch BSP thread and thread pitch is 14 threads per inch.
